Problem I use the Enpass Browser Extension from Chome Web Store for managing my passwords. In Chrome it is working fine with showing up matching entries in form fields (see screenshot below), in Thorium it is not. The settings for the extenstion are the same in both browsers

I think this is related to Enpass not being able to find the NativeMessagingHosts of the Thorium browser. You can check the Enpass documentation to see if there is a related solution.
